Mastering the B2 Level: A Comprehensive Guide to Online Exam Preparation Materials
Achieving a B2 level according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) is a substantial milestone for any language learner. Often referred to as "Upper-Intermediate," this level represents that a speaker can communicate with a degree of fluency and spontaneity, comprehend complicated texts, and produce clear, detailed descriptions on various subjects. Since of its significance for university admissions and professional advancement, the need for B2 accreditation-- such as the Cambridge B2 First (FCE), IELTS (Band 5.5-- 6.5), or the DELF B2-- is at an all-time high.
Luckily, the digital age has supplied a frustrating abundance of resources. Navigating this large sea of info, however, requires a tactical method. This guide examines the most effective online products available for B2 exam preparation, classified to assist candidates construct a balanced research study strategy.
Comprehending the B2 Competency Profile
Before diving into materials, it is vital to comprehend what is tested at this level. A B2 prospect is expected to:
- Understand the primary ideas of intricate text on both concrete and abstract subjects.
- Interact with native speakers without stress for either party.
- Produce clear, comprehensive text on a wide variety of subjects.
- Explain a perspective on a topical concern, providing the advantages and downsides of different options.
Important Categories of Online Materials
1. Authorities Exam Board Websites
The most trusted starting point for any prospect is the site of the specific exam supplier. These websites offer the "Gold Standard" of materials because they reflect the precise format and problem level of the actual test.
- Cambridge Assessment English: Provides complimentary sample papers, vocabulary lists, and "Write & & Improve "tools particularly created for the B2 First.
- The British Council: Offers a wealth of grammar exercises and listening activities customized to upper-intermediate students.
- ETS (for TOEFL) and IDP/IELTS: Provide practice tests that mimic the timing and pressure of the main exam environment.
2. Interactive Learning Platforms and MOOCs
Huge Open Online Courses (MOOCs) provide structured knowing that reproduces a class environment. These are perfect for trainees who need a guided path rather than a self-directed search for products.
- Coursera and edX: Frequently host courses from leading universities targeted at academic English and B2-level proficiency.
- Udemy: Often features specialized "B2 Masterclasses" that focus particularly on exam hacks and time management strategies.
3. Skill-Specific Resources
To succeed at the B2 level, a candidate needs to stabilize four main abilities: Reading, Writing, Listening, and Speaking.
Listening and Speaking
YouTube has actually ended up being an indispensable tool for B2 preparation. Channels such as English with Lucy, mmmEnglish, and BBC Learning English deal devoted playlists for B2 students. Moreover, podcasts like The English We Speak or TED Talks (with transcripts) permit trainees to practice listening to various accents and complicated topic.
Reading and Writing
The B2 level requires exposure to genuine texts. Reading trustworthy news outlets like The Guardian, The New York Times, or The Economist helps prospects acquaint themselves with the "Use of English" and advanced syntax. For composing, online tools like Grammarly or Ludwig.guru can help students fine-tune their syntax and find out formal vs. casual registers.
